Samsung Electronics Co-CEO Han Jong-Hee Dies of Cardiac Arrest at 63

Samsung Electronics co-CEO Han Jong-Hee passed away on Tuesday at the age of 63 due to cardiac arrest, a spokesperson for the South Korean tech giant confirmed.

Born in 1962, Han had been overseeing Samsung’s consumer electronics and mobile devices businesses since 2022. That same year, he was appointed vice chairman and co-CEO alongside Jun Young-Hyun, who leads the company’s semiconductor division.

In an internal message seen by CNN, Samsung honored Han’s contributions, highlighting his 37 years of dedication to the company. The message credited him with leading Samsung’s TV business to global prominence and strengthening its electronics and appliances divisions despite a “challenging business environment.”

“Our deepest condolences are with his family and loved ones during this difficult time,” the company stated.

Samsung has not yet announced a successor, the spokesperson added.
